Output cdb64f4d8afc995e6a4692105433e182f823a936f436285e7d44b86c8ca4ce06:27

value
50572491
script pubkey
OP_HASH160 OP_PUSHBYTES_20 93209ff433696f45f9389796ed09ba264ad8dd6c OP_EQUAL
address
MMK6eSZRigJV2PGmoxN1hX3MwYRLLwzxqj
transaction
cdb64f4d8afc995e6a4692105433e182f823a936f436285e7d44b86c8ca4ce06
spent
true